Hematology · Multiple Myeloma
The ongoing clinical trial of Isatuximab during stem cell transplantation could significantly impact treatment protocols for multiple myeloma and lymphoma. Positive results may enhance Isatuximab's competitive positioning and expand its therapeutic indications, influencing market dynamics in hematology.
